Understanding the Fundamentals: Essential Skills for Success

To excel in clinical trial data management and analysis, individuals must possess a unique blend of technical, analytical, and communication skills. Proficiency in programming languages such as SQL, Python, and R is crucial for data manipulation and analysis. Additionally, a solid understanding of statistical concepts, data visualization tools, and data quality control measures is essential for ensuring the integrity and accuracy of clinical trial data. Effective communication and collaboration skills are also vital, as data managers and analysts must work closely with cross-functional teams, including clinicians, researchers, and regulatory professionals.

Implementing Best Practices: Strategies for Optimal Data Management

Best practices in clinical trial data management and analysis are critical for ensuring the quality, reliability, and compliance of research studies. One key strategy is to implement a robust data management plan, which outlines procedures for data collection, storage, and analysis. Another essential best practice is to conduct regular data quality checks, using tools such as data validation and data cleaning to identify and rectify errors. Furthermore, adopting a risk-based approach to data management, which prioritizes critical data elements and mitigates potential risks, can help to ensure the integrity of clinical trial data. By implementing these best practices, professionals can minimize errors, reduce costs, and optimize the efficiency of clinical trials.

Staying Ahead of the Curve: Emerging Trends and Technologies

The field of clinical trial data management and analysis is rapidly evolving, with emerging trends and technologies transforming the way research studies are conducted. One key area of innovation is the use of artificial intelligence (AI) and machine learning (ML) algorithms, which can help to automate data processing, identify patterns! and predict outcomes. Another exciting development is the adoption of cloud-based data management platforms, which enable secure, scalable, and collaborative data sharing. By staying informed about these emerging trends and technologies, professionals can leverage the latest tools and techniques to optimize clinical trial data management and analysis, driving more efficient, effective, and patient-centric research studies.
